How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Far West Travis?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Far West Travis Studio Apartments | $1,583 | $649 | $2,120 |
| Far West Travis 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,541 | $875 | $7,167 |
| Far West Travis 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,931 | $925 | $4,914 |
| Far West Travis 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,487 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
| Far West Travis 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,975 | $1,499 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Far West Travis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Far West Travis?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Far West Travis with Washer/Dryer is at MAA Canyon Creek listed at $908.
How much is the average rent for Far West Travis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Far West Travis with Washer/Dryer is $2,363.
What is the largest Far West Travis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Far West Travis is a 2,963 square feet unit starting from $1,138 at Gramercy at Northline.
What is the average size for Far West Travis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Far West Travis is currently at 745 sq ft.
